Q: Is 357,231 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 357,231 is a composite number.

Why is 357,231 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 357,231 can be evenly divided by 1 3 7 21 17,011 51,033 119,077 and 357,231, with no remainder.

Since 357,231 cannot be divided by just 1 and 357,231, it is a composite number.
